- See Image Mrs. M. Leppla Dies on Sunday; Mrs. Marie H. Leppl a, 88, died Sunday at the Bishop Noa home. She was born November 21st, 18 82 in St. John's, Wisconsin, and her husband, Walter, died February 5th, 1 963. Mrs. Leppla was a member of the Third Order of St. Francis and St. J oseph Church. She is survived by three daughters, Mrs. James (Zerelda) Li ttle of Chicago, Miss Doris Leppla, of Ashland, Wisconsin, and Mrs. Matth ew E. (Helen) Erickson of Chevy Chase, Maryland. One sister, Mrs. Herbe rt Schowalter of West Bend, Wisconsin, and one grandchild, Michael. Frien ds may call at the Boyce Funeral home from 432 9:30 p.m. Tuesday and pari sh prayers will be recited at 8:00 p.m.. Funeral services will be conduct ed at 9:00 a.m. Wednesday at St. Joseph's church. Burial will be in Ho ly Cross cemetery.

- 1903 Kaukauna Times dated 4/24/1903; Married at 6 o'clock wednesday morni ng at Holy Cross parsonage, Rev. Julius Rhode officiating, Miss Marie Fell er, daughter of Mr. & Mrs Peter J. Feller to Wallie Leppla. Miss Julia O'C onnell acted as bridesmaid and Harry Langlois as groomsman. The wedding w as a quiet affair and was only attended by immediate relatives. A weddi ng breakfast followed at the home of the bride's parents after which th ey departed on the 7:38 morning train to visit Mr. Leppla's parents at Med ina and relatives of the bride in St. Paul, Minn and Sioux Falls, South Da kota.Mr. & Mrs. Leppla will reside on Eighth street, where a cozy home awaits t heir return. Mr. Leppla is in the employ of the Northwestern railroad comp any of the Ashland division office in this city as train dispatcher and Mi ss Feller until a week ago held a position as operator and local manager f or Postal Telegraph company. Both are well known young people with a ho st of friends, all of which extend their best wishes. The TIMES joins in t he congratulations and trusts their voyage through life may be a happy a nd prosperous one.
